** The Toyota repair market in and around Tamaroa, Illinois, is characteristic of a rural area. There are no Toyota-specific specialist shops located directly within Tamaroa itself. The market is served by a handful of reputable, long-standing independent repair shops in neighboring towns like Du Quoin and Pinckneyville. These shops provide general auto repair with the capability to service Toyotas, often at labor rates significantly lower than a dealership ($85-$110/hr vs. $130-$150/hr). Competition is moderate among these local providers, with reputation and word-of-mouth being critical to their success. For specialized services—particularly hybrid system repair, manufacturer warranty work, and performance upgrades—residents must travel to the nearest dealership in Mt. Vernon, which is approximately a 30-minute drive. The overall quality of service from the local independents is generally considered good to high for mechanical work (engines, transmissions), but the most advanced diagnostics and model-specific expertise are concentrated at the dealership level. Pricing for standard repairs is competitive and below urban averages, but complex issues may require the resources of the dealership.

Given the rural roads and occasional harsh winters in the Tamaroa area, common issues include suspension components (struts, control arms) from potholes, brake system wear from gravel and dust, and undercarriage corrosion from winter road treatments. Regular inspections for these wear items are crucial for local driving conditions.
Labor rates at shops serving the Tamaroa region are often moderately lower than in major metropolitan areas like St. Louis. However, for specialized parts or diagnostics, some shops may have slightly higher part costs or transportation fees due to the rural location, so it's wise to get a detailed estimate upfront.
For routine maintenance (oil changes, tire rotations) and most general repairs, a trusted local independent shop in Perry County can be more convenient and cost-effective. For complex hybrid system issues, advanced diagnostics, or warranty-covered repairs, you will need to visit an authorized Toyota dealership, which requires a trip to a nearby city.
